Ordinals
beta
Address 13ZAcgUgE8aKPd4n1Fhyr8S76j8QfnrW9D
sat balance
29796
outputs
b51cda28fda29f94e6d8abd42cf12b80544d3deb29c9aa6d097dcb5b8b390b84:1